Abstract:
OBJECTIVE:To observe the effects of matrine in conjunction with vincristine(VCR),adriamycin(ADM)and diamminedichloroplatinum(DDP),respectively on the cell cycle of the KBV200drug-resistant cell line.METHODS:The cultured KBV drug-resistant cells were divided into control group,antitumor drug groups and the combination therapy groups(marine+antitumor drugs,respectively),FCM assay was used to detect and analyze the expression of cell cycle and apoptosis of each group.RESULTS:As compared with single antitumor drugs groups,no significant change was found in the proportion of cells and cell apoptosis in the combination therapy groups(matrine+VCR or matrine+ADM).But marine+DDD resulted in a reduction of the G 0 ~G 1 stage cell population but an increase of G 2 ~M stage cell population.CONCLUSIONS:It was assumed that matrine-induced reversal of KBV200cells'drug-resistant to VCR and ADM may not relate to cell cycle and cell apoptosis.Matrine can slightly enhance the cytotoxic effect of DDP.
